History

Origins and Founding

, the lead singer of during the 1980s, first discovered on band trips to , , where the laid-back atmosphere and vibrant inspired his vision for a rock 'n' roll haven. During these late-1980s visits, Hagar partnered with local entrepreneurs Jorge Viana and Marco Monroy, whose collaboration solidified the concept for the Cabo Wabo Cantina. In April 1990, , Viana, and Monroy opened the original Cabo Wabo Cantina in , a rock 'n' roll-themed bar and restaurant featuring live music, memorabilia, and signature margaritas. The opening celebration included Hagar's first Birthday Bash and drew for performances, establishing the venue's reputation for high-energy events and celebrity gatherings. At the time, was rapidly evolving from a sleepy into a burgeoning tourist destination, with new resorts and infrastructure drawing international visitors and amplifying the cantina's appeal as a hotspot for music fans. The initial co-ownership structure united Hagar's promotional star power with Viana's operational expertise and Monroy's financial and architectural contributions, forming a balanced that propelled the cantina's early success. Ownership Changes

In 2007, sold an 80% stake in Cabo Wabo Tequila to Gruppo Campari, the Italian spirits company, for $80 million, while retaining a 20% ownership interest and continuing to provide creative input on the brand. Three years later, in 2010, Hagar divested his remaining 20% share to Campari for an additional $11 million, bringing the total sale value to $91 million and fully transferring control of the tequila brand to the company. Unlike the tequila brand, ownership of the original Cabo Wabo Cantina in remained with and his original partners, including Jorge Viana and Marco Monroy, well beyond the tequila transactions. Venues

Original Cantina

The original Cabo Wabo Cantina is situated in the heart of , , , at Vicente Guerrero S/N in the Centro neighborhood, offering a prime marina-side location that immerses visitors in the vibrant pulse of the area's nightlife. The venue embodies a rock 'n' roll aesthetic, adorned with memorabilia honoring and fellow musicians, complemented by a massive central stage dedicated to live performances and spacious interiors accommodating around 600 guests across multiple levels, including a dance floor, seating areas, and an outdoor patio bar. The menu emphasizes bold flavors and celebratory beverages, featuring signature margaritas like the house Wabo Rita, hearty dishes such as sizzling fajitas, cheesy enchiladas, and Baja-style fish tacos, alongside a selection of tequila-centric cocktails and shots using the proprietary Cabo Wabo as the house brand. Daily operations run from 9:00 AM to 2:00 AM, with live music fueling the energy—house bands perform Thursday through Sunday, acoustic sets grace the patio in the afternoons, and the interior stage hosts evening shows—while happy hours from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M offer buy-one-get-one-free deals on margaritas and domestic beers, alongside occasional themed events for parties and gatherings. Since its 1990 debut, the Cantina has solidified its status as a cornerstone tourist landmark in , seamlessly blending dining, drinking, and entertainment into the local nightlife scene and drawing crowds for its high-energy vibe. It hosts Sammy Hagar's annual Birthday Bash, a multi-night concert series featuring the rocker alongside surprise guests like Michael Anthony, Vic Johnson, , , and , which has become a pilgrimage for fans and celebrities alike. Expansions and Additional Locations

The expansion of Cabo Wabo beyond its original cantina in began in the mid-2000s, with the establishment of U.S.-based outposts designed to replicate the rock 'n' roll atmosphere, live music, and festive dining experience of the flagship location. The first U.S. venue opened on April 30, 2004, at Resort Casino in , , offering a high-energy and space that hosted live and drew crowds for its margaritas and Mexican-inspired menu. This location operated for over a decade before closing, marking an early effort to bring the brand's party vibe to American casino destinations. In November 2009, Cabo Wabo Cantina debuted on the Las Vegas Strip at the in Resort & Casino, spanning 15,000 square feet with a multi-level layout including a rooftop , live music stages, and themed decor evoking Sammy Hagar's rock heritage. The venue has hosted numerous events featuring Hagar and guest artists, maintaining its status as a staple for live entertainment and casual dining amid the Strip's . It remains operational, emphasizing the brand's enduring appeal in major entertainment hubs. Additional U.S. expansions included a short-lived location in , which opened in 2008 but closed by December of that year due to operational challenges. A Hollywood outpost at Hollywood & Highland Center launched in the early 2010s, blending the cantina's beach-town energy with Tinseltown flair through live bands and themed nights; the official venue closed around 2022. Tequila Brand

Development and Launch

The development of Cabo Wabo Tequila stemmed from Sammy 's frustration with the mediocre quality of s served at his Cabo Wabo in , , prompting him to seek a superior option tailored to the venue. As a tequila enthusiast who had discovered the spirit during trips to , , Hagar partnered with local distiller Juan Eduardo Nuñez at Tequila El Viejito to produce a premium 100% tequila, emphasizing hand-crafted purity over mass-produced alternatives. This collaboration began in the mid-1990s, with initial production involving small-scale methods like transporting spirit in 5-gallon gas cans to ensure . Launched in 1996, Cabo Wabo debuted as a premium 100% blanco , initially available exclusively at the original before expanding to select U.S. markets. The brand positioned itself in the nascent premium segment, bottled in distinctive hand-blown blue glass to evoke artisanal craftsmanship, and quickly gained traction among patrons seeking an authentic, high-end experience. Early distribution remained limited, focusing on Hagar's personal network rather than broad retail, which allowed for organic growth tied to the cantina's popularity. Initial marketing leveraged Hagar's rock star persona as the former Van Halen frontman, integrating the tequila into his lifestyle branding through personal endorsements and high-profile tastings at celebrity events. Hagar promoted it via custom apparel like "Got Tequila?" T-shirts and appearances on television, framing Cabo Wabo as an extension of his fun-loving, party-centric image from the 1980s and early 1990s Van Halen era. This celebrity-driven approach helped differentiate it in a market dominated by generic imports, fostering word-of-mouth buzz among music fans and vacationers. Despite its promise, early challenges included scaling production amid limited agave supplies in Jalisco, where most output favored larger brands, and navigating competition from emerging premium rivals like Patrón. Hagar's distillery partner faced tax issues, leading to a switch to Agaveros Unidos de Amatitán by 1999, while the cantina's initial financial struggles complicated brand rollout. These hurdles tested the venture's viability in the still-developing U.S. premium tequila landscape, where consumer education on 100% agave spirits was minimal.

Products and Production

Cabo Wabo Tequila produces three core variants, all made from 100% blue Weber and bottled at 40% ABV. The Blanco is unaged, offering a crisp expression of pure with and notes. The Reposado is aged for 2 to 11 months in American barrels, developing a balanced profile of , , and subtle spice. The Añejo undergoes at least 12 months of aging in , resulting in richer flavors of , toasted nuts, and lingering sweetness. The production process emphasizes traditional methods with a signature "Thick Cut" approach to maximize agave intensity. Blue Weber agave plants, sourced from the highlands of , , are harvested after 8 to 12 years of growth. The piñas are slow-cooked in autoclaves to convert starches into sugars, then crushed using roller mills to extract the nectar, which is fermented in tanks with natural yeast. The resulting wash is double-distilled in copper pot stills for purity and smoothness. Since Campari Group's acquisition in 2007, production has been overseen at certified facilities in the region to ensure consistency and adherence to strict quality standards. Cabo Wabo Tequilas are renowned for their smooth and approachable flavor profiles, featuring prominent brightness in the Blanco, evolving to and light smoke in the Reposado, and deeper integration in the Añejo. These characteristics stem from the careful blending post-distillation and aging. The brand has earned recognition for quality, including Double Gold medals at the World Spirits Competition for its Reposado and other expressions in competitions dating back to 2006, as well as a Best in Show award at the 2024 TAG Global Spirits Awards for Reposado. Branding

The Cabo Wabo logo was originally designed in 1990 by Noel Vestri for the signage of the inaugural cantina in , . Vestri, known for innovative computer graphic work including designs for footwear, created a distinctive mark that captured the brand's rock 'n' roll energy blended with influences. The core design consists of the brand name rendered in a weathered western-style font, often enclosed in a crest-like element symbolizing heritage and vitality. When the tequila line launched in 1996, the logo was adapted and trademarked for spirits use. This extension protected the visual identity across products, emphasizing its role in distinguishing the ultra-premium in a competitive . The design's draws from cultural motifs and the lively spirit of Hagar's musical background, evoking celebration and adventure. Over time, variations have emerged to suit different applications while maintaining core recognition. Neon-lit versions illuminate exteriors and interiors, providing a vibrant, ambiance. For tequila bottles, a 2009 redesign introduced metallic foil accents on the logo's , enhancing visual appeal with panoramic Mexican landscapes on the reverse label side. Marketing and Cultural Significance

Cabo Wabo's marketing strategies have heavily relied on Hagar's personal endorsements as the brand's longtime ambassador, leveraging his rock star persona to promote the through authentic storytelling and direct involvement in creative decisions. Hagar's endorsement has been pivotal since the brand's inception, emphasizing quality and lifestyle appeal without compromising on product integrity. A key promotional tie-in has been the annual Cabo Wabo Birthday Bash, hosted by Hagar at the original cantina in every October since 1990, which draws thousands of fans for multi-night concerts featuring guest artists and reinforces the brand's rock 'n' roll roots. The 2025 event featured performances with guests including , , and . Additionally, early partnerships emerged from promotional contests, such as one where restaurateur won for top Cabo Wabo sales, fostering connections that later influenced Hagar's subsequent ventures. The brand holds significant cultural resonance as a symbol of and rock excess, embodying the era's party lifestyle through Hagar's experiences in that inspired the song "Cabo Wabo" on their 1988 album OU812. The term "Cabo Wabo," coined by to describe a wobbly walk after heavy drinking, captured the carefree, indulgent spirit of rock tourism and became synonymous with escapism in Mexican beach destinations. Cabo Wabo pioneered the celebrity trend upon its 1996 U.S. launch, predating high-profile lines like Cuervo's specials and setting a model for musicians to authentically endorse spirits tied to their personal narratives.
